[PATCH] Fix IXP4xx watchdog errata workaround

From: Deepak Saxena
Date: Tue Jan 03 2006 - 15:50:20 EST


The IXP4xx driver bails out on all A0 CPUs, but it should only do
so on IXP42x as IXP46x has functioning HW.

Signed-off-by: Deepak Saxena <dsaxena@xxxxxxxxxxx>

---


Index: linux-2.6-git/drivers/char/watchdog/ixp4xx_wdt.c
===================================================================
--- linux-2.6-git.orig/drivers/char/watchdog/ixp4xx_wdt.c
+++ linux-2.6-git/drivers/char/watchdog/ixp4xx_wdt.c
@@ -186,8 +186,8 @@ static int __init ixp4xx_wdt_init(void)
unsigned long processor_id;

asm("mrc p15, 0, %0, cr0, cr0, 0;" : "=r"(processor_id) :);
- if (!(processor_id & 0xf)) {
- printk("IXP4XXX Watchdog: Rev. A0 CPU detected - "
+ if (!(processor_id & 0xf) && !cpu_is_ixp46x()) {
+ printk("IXP4XXX Watchdog: Rev. A0 IXP42x CPU detected - "
"watchdog disabled\n");

return -ENODEV;
